Easily one of the most satisfying finales that I've seen. I kept wishing they hadn't made it such a short lived series from the premiere but the fact they knew how everything was going to play out really helped instead of some off the wall and rushed conclusion. It was a great show and Goggins maintains that he's one of the best out there. He stole every scene but the chemistry between him and McBride was aces. I keep seeing people mentioning how "dark" it got and I wouldn't argue that, but the way they kept the humor flowing through all of it without it being distracting and actually working in its favor showed what a talent everyone involved was. Sad to see the show come to an end, but happy that I can now openly talk about my experience as an extra on the show with friends and family. It was a fun set to be on, and it's awesome to see all of the behind-the-scenes work play out.
The two season arc was great, and things wrapped up perfectly. As much as I'd like to see more of the characters (and be a part of the show again), I hope HBO doesn't try to force a third season at some point in the future. If McBride and Hill have a great idea to revisit the show on down the line, I'm all for it. But short of that, I'm happy to have it as is. |
